Abstract

The research aims to determine effect of composting of cocoa fruit peel with some NPK dose and get the best treatment on the growth seedling of oil palm (Elaeis guineensis Jacq.) in the main nursery. This research was conducted in the experimental fields of Agriculture faculty, Riau University, Bina Widya Street Km 12,5 Simpang Baru, Tampan Pekanbaru. Research was held 4 months, starting from February 2015 until May 2015. Research using experiment design with Completely Randomize Design (CRD) consisting of 5 treatments every treatment was repeated 4 times, and retrieved 20 units of experiment, each unit consisting of 2 seed. The total were 40 seed and observed doing to all seed, the treatment is combination cocoa fruit peel compost with some NPK dose. Parameters observed were the increase of seeds height, increase of leaves, increase of hump convolution, volume of root, root shoot ratio and dry weight. Data were analyzed statistically using ANOVA and followed by DNMRT at level of 5%. The results showed that composting of cocoa fruit peel with some NPK dose significant effect on increase of seeds height, increase of hump convolution, volume of root, root shoot ratio and dry weight but not significant on increase of leaves. Composting of cocoa fruit peel 150 g/polybag + 1 NPK dose give the best growth oil palm seed.   Keywords : Palm oil, cocoa fruit peel compost and NPK.

Abstract

 This study aims to examine the effect of liquid bio-slurry and get the best dose on the growth and yield of the pakcoy (Brassica rapa L.) plant. The experiment was conducted at Experimental Garden of Agriculture Faculty of Riau University, Campus Bina Widya km 12,5 Simpang Baru Village Tampan Sub District, Pekanbaru. This research was conducted for 2 months, from August to September 2017. The research was conducted experimentally using Randomized Complete Design (RAL). The practice is liquid bio-slurry (B) comprising five levels with doses: B0 = Without liquid bio-slurry, B1 = 2 liters of liquid bio-slurry.m-2, B2 = 4 liters of liquid bio-lurry.m- 2, B3 = 6 liters of liquid bio-slurry.m-2, B4 = 8 liters of liquid bio-slurry.m-2. Each treatment was repeated four times so that there were 20 experimental units. The observational data were analyzed statistically by using Analysis of Varian SAS 9.1 untuk windows,then continued with BNT test at 5% level. The observed parameters consist of plant height, leaf number, leaf area, fresh weight of plant per m2, consumption weight per m2. The results showed that the provision of liquid bio-slurry can increase the growth and yield of the pakcoy plant at a dose of 6 l.m-2 gives the best results on the growth and yield of the pakcoy plant. Keywords: Liquid Bio Slurry and Pakcoy

The research objective was to determine optimum dosage of “mutiara” NPK (16:16:16) fertilizer and various type of mulch for chili plant yield. This research was conducted at experimental plot, Faculty of Agriculture, Riau University from September 2007 until January 2008. The experimental method used was Randomized Block Design in factorial. The first factor was level of NPK fertilizer (N) namely: without NPK (N0), 125 ton/ha NPK (N1), and 250 ton/ha NPK (N2). The second factor was various organic mulch (M) namely: oil palm empty fruit bunch  (TKKS) 10 ton/ha (M1), paddy chaff 10 ton/ha (M2), and hay 10 ton/ha (M3). Parameters observed were harvest time, number of fruits per plant, weight of fruits per plant, and the percentage of consumable fruits. The result showed that supplying “mutiara” NPK (16:16:16) fertilizer dosage of 250 kg/ha together with rough rice bran mulch or TKKS gave better results than other treatments.

Abstract

Gold snail (Pomacea canaliculata L.) is the main pest of rice plants in Empat Balai Village, Kuok District, Kampar Regency. Farmers in Empat Balai Village experience gold snail infestation every year, which has an impact on production. The purpose of community service activities is to conduct community service by counseling and controlling carp pests in rice fields by utilizing local wisdom in Empat Balai Village. The methods in this service are survey, consolidation, counseling and field practice. The counseling was held at Mushallah Miftahul Jannah in Pulau Empat Hamlet, while the field practice was at the farmer’s house and rice fields in Empat Balai Village. The material provided was about bioecology and how to control the carp snail pest. It was emphasized that the recommended control carp pests are the management of carp pests in the egg phase, because one group of eggs has 500 eggs and control is easier in the egg phase. Control in the egg phase includes making drainage or small ditches, installing bamboo stakes so that the snails lay their eggs there, and collecting the eggs once a week. In the snail phase, involves setting up attractant plant traps (gadung tuber leaf, papaya leaf, and banana leaf), kalambuai traps (kaltrap), installing of irrigated nets, utilizing ducks, and vegetable molluscicides. In addition, preventive measure was taken, such as planting older seedlings. The farmers were very enthusiastic about this activity. As a result, farmers gained additional knowledge about gold snail pests and how to control them, improve farmers skills on gold snail pests control methods by utilizing local wisdom.
